Different Welder’s Certificates

While the American Welding Society’s regular Certified Welder certificate opens the door for almost all work opportunities, many industries demand a specialized certificate. Several of the most-well-known of which are listed below.

  • ASME Certification for those that deal with boiler and pressurized containers
  •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der
  • API Certification for individuals who deal with pipelines in the oil and gas industry
  • CWI and SCWI Certificates for inspectors and senior inspectors

The subsequent graphic shows earnings and jobs projections for welders in Maryland through 2022.

Maryland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 2,620 2,700 3% 70
Maryland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$28,000 $42,700 $69,800

Source: O*Net Online

What You Should be Ready For in Welding Training

There are several matters you should consider if you are prepared to choose between welding schools. It might seem as if there are tons of welding specialist classes in Davidsonville, MD, but you still need to select the program that can best guide you to your professional aspirations. Official certification by the AWS is probably the most important feature that can help you choose the best training programs. While not as necessary as accreditation, you should look at a few of the following parts also:

  • Be certain the program trains with equipment that meets present field standards
  • Find out if the college offers financial assistance
  • Be sure the school’s program provides you with courses in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
  • Try to find programs that cover AWS SENSE standards
